GTX 690 would be a no compromise card – quieter and less power hungry than GTX 680 SLI, as fast as GTX 680 in single-GPU performance, and as fast as GTX 680 SLI in multi-GPU performance.
As always NVIDIA is going to be doing some binning here to snag the best GK104 GPUs for the GTX 690, which is the other factor in bringing down power consumption versus the 2x195W GTX 680 SLI.

The GeForce GTX 690 was a enthusiast-class graphics card by NVIDIA, launched in May 2012. Built on the 28 nm process, and based on the GK104 graphics processor, in its GK104-355-A2 variant, the card supports DirectX 12.0.
